本文简述了乳浓聚合动力学研究的进展,着重于澳大利亚Sydney大学Gilbert等在乳液聚合阶段Ⅱ动力学方面的研究概况。介绍了不同水溶性单体的小尺寸种子乳液体系的SmithEwart递推方程的求解方法及其解析解形式和乳液聚合动力学数据的处理。同时讨论了该研究的局限性。
In this paper, the progress of kinematic studies of emulsion polymerization was briefly reviewed, focusing on the research overview of Gilbert et al. At Sydney University in Australia in the kinetics of emulsion polymerization. The solving method of SmithEwart recursion equation of small size seed emulsion system with different water-soluble monomers and its analytical solution and the data processing of emulsion polymerization kinetics are introduced. The limitations of the study are also discussed.
